I bought Redmond Real Salt - All Natural Sea Salt. But further down it also says, Unrefined sea salt mined from ancient sea bed - Contains 50+ trace minerals, including iodine. This isn't the salt I should be using is it. I'm confused on the non iodized and contains iodine...
Terri's Answer: Jodie, that is a great question as it can be confusing. Regular Table Salt is stripped of trace minerals and iodine is added back into the salt. You basically have sodium chloride in it.
The reason sea salt is much better (especially
Himalayan Pink Salt) is that it contains the natural iodine as well as numerous trace minerals that are needed and used by our bodies.
Having all of these trace minerals in your salt keeps the balance that nature intended and is healthier for your body. Some believe that iodized table salt is toxic because it does not have a natural balance.
